Output 91ab6923bc4e51cf1da31495e363d5421180ff6b7e5484bbf14f0a1808935fcb:0

value
40073562
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 65dc27add8e62e91e7e8fe27088851bc2fed9865 OP_EQUALVERIFY OP_CHECKSIG
address
1AHaz1i2921kB8zS4K5UwsU6JHmyNADcfb
transaction
91ab6923bc4e51cf1da31495e363d5421180ff6b7e5484bbf14f0a1808935fcb
spent
true